Establishment profile
STAHL SPECIALTY COMPANY
1301 STAHL DRIVE, WARRENSBURG, MO, 64093
331524 — Aluminum Foundries (except Die-Casting)
Summary
STAHL SPECIALTY COMPANY has accumulated 52 OSHA violations across 15 inspections over 52 years of recorded history, with $142,623 in total assessed penalties.
The establishment sits in the 91st percentile for violations within its industry-state peer group of 65 employers. Inspection frequency runs at the 97th percentile. The most recent enforcement activity was recorded 4 months ago.

OSHA accident events
Accidents, fatalities, and catastrophes documented during OSHA inspections at this employer. Each entry links to the inspection that recorded it.
| Date | Event | Injuries | Hospitalized | Fatalities |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Jan 7, 2022 | Caught Between,Crushed,Molding Machine,PinnedFatality | 1 | — | 1 | |
| Feb 15, 2016 | Caught In,Crushing,Lockout/Tagout,Struck ByFatality | 1 | — | 1 |
Source: OSHA accident investigations. Narratives are recorded by the inspecting officer and may be truncated.
